Are you confusing RAM with hard disc space? Where are you checking to see how much RAM there is? Go under Control Panel/System. System Properties on the General tab will show the amount of RAM installed. If you're looking under Windows Task Manager, it may be that it will only show 24mb of available RAM, but it should show the total of 256mb. There are two entries under System Information (Start/All Programs/Accessories/System Tools/System Information): 1. Total Physical Memory (my system has 512mb) 2. Total Available Memory (my system currently shows 264mb) My guess is that what is showing only 24mb is Total Available Memory. Check to see what processes are running in the background by bringing up Task Manager (use the three finger salute - ctl/alt/delete).
